A hotswap 75% RGB Custom Mechanical keyboard.
Make example for this keyboard (after setting up your build environment):
make melgeek/tegic/rev1:default
Enter the bootloader in 3 ways:
Bootmagic reset: Hold down the key at (0,0) in the matrix (usually the top left key or Escape) and plug in the keyboard *
Physical reset button: Briefly press the button on the back of the PCB - some may have pads you must short instead *
Keycode in layout: Press the key mapped to QK_BOOT
if it is available *
